CVE-2023-22319 is a critical SQL injection vulnerability affecting Milesight VPN v2.0.2, specifically within the requestHandlers.js LoginAuth functionality. This flaw allows an unauthenticated attacker to bypass authentication by sending a specially crafted network request. With a CVSS score of 9.8, this vulnerability poses a severe risk, enabling full compromise of confidentiality, integrity, and availability. While there is no known public exploit code or active exploitation (KEV), the vulnerability has garnered some community discussion and media coverage, indicating awareness within the cybersecurity landscape.
